What are the six characteristics of living things? | 1. Living things produce waste 2. Living things have a life span 3. Living things require energy 4. Living things respond to the environment 5.Living things reproduce, grow, and repair themselves 6. Living things are composed of cells.

What does the mitochondria do? | Mitochondria provides the cells with energy. In repiration the mitochondria will release energy by combining sugar molecules and oxgen to create carbon dioxide and water.
